**Ticket: Expired credentials blocking dark-mode rollout**

The Ledgerlight admin dashboard's dark-mode toggle reads theme prefs from the Prefstore service. That integration's key expired Tuesday, so the toggle silently fails and users stay in light mode. New team members: theme calls are in `theme_client.py`; errors surface in Spanview as 401s. Fix is straightforward — swap in the rotated key and redeploy. A fresh key has been issued for the Prefstore integration, shown below.

API key for yahig-tadup: kto7_ubizbYm

Handover note — shift change. Morrick Couriers missed yesterday's 14:00 pick-up at Bay 3; no call ahead, no reschedule. We've switched the run to Telvane Express effective today. Same pallet, same manifest, new driver badge format. Flag the change to the gatehouse so the new driver isn't turned away. The confidential hand-over instruction for the replacement courier is the single line that follows.

dispatch memo: the quenax olidor courier leaves the lamvan aldath keliel ledger at gate 2085 under passcode 005795

## Deploying the Gatewick Proctor Queue

Deploys are pretty painless: push to main, wait for the pipeline, then watch the queue drain dashboard for five minutes. If candidates pile up mid-exam, roll back first and ask questions later — the queue replays safely. Everything the workers care about lives in one config block, shown here for reference.

settings of bafof-yagef:
JOROX_PIN=8740
JOROX_TENANT=pelox
JOROX_METRICS_HOST=metrics.jorox.qorvelworks.internal
JOROX_SEAL=seal_c78f63c1
JOROX_STANDBY_TEAM=norax

# Break-Glass Access — TrailMark Offline Mode

Welcome aboard! TrailMark, our field-survey app, caches forms locally so surveyors can work without signal out near the Dunmoor ridgelines. If sync fails for 48+ hours, break-glass access lets you unlock the local vault and export raw data manually. Use it sparingly — every use gets audited by the Harrowfen ops crew. When prompted by the recovery screen, enter the passphrase below.

strongbox words: zorath-holmir